Default 6 year old Edge 15051

Hi all, I've stumbled upon an edge, with dash pod, all cables and instruction manual on craigslist for 175 obo. What I'm concerned about is he said the dash pod is a little faded from 6 years of Texas sun. Is a unit this old still trustworthy? If I offered him 150 would that be a good deal for me? Would you pass on one this old? Thanks for any help you can offer.

I would think they either work as normal, or not at all. It's not like they get tired after a few years. I would get it. And if the faded plastic looks bad to you, then just get a new one. I think they are like $30 for the plastic. Offer him $100 and see what happens.

Just download the Fusion software to your computer and update it. There may be multiple udates available, so keep checking until there isn't one left. Do this before you load it on your truck.
